Novak Djokovic: 'I had to stay mentally focused'

Djokovic pleased with mental toughness

Novak Djokovic has praised Mikhail Kukushkin for pushing him all the way in their Shanghai Masters third-round encounter, saying that it was the "toughest match" he has faced in the competition so far.

The top seed was made to work hard this afternoon, eventually prevailing 6-3 4-6 6-4 to see off the world number 85.

"He pushed me to the last point," Djokovic is quoted as saying by BBC Sport. "He deserves credit for how he played. Some shots were incredible.

"I've never played him so it was difficult for me to get into the match. He was making winners from all over the place. I had to back off.

"This is something that definitely gives me more confidence. It was definitely the toughest match I've had so far in China. I'm really glad I managed to stay mentally tough."

The reigning champion will now face David Ferrer in the quarter-finals.
